    November 10th Republican debate on Fox Business Network - Official Thread

    Who and when:

    Fox Business hosts Neil Cavuto and Maria Bartiromo are set to moderate tonight’s GOP Debate from the Milwaukee Theater in Milwaukee, Wisconsin. Wall Street Journal‘s Editor-In-Chief Gerard Baker will also be moderating. The debate pool will again be split into an undercard portion at 7 p.m. EST and the top eight candidates will take the stage for the main event at 9 p.m. EST.

    ..

    The undercard candidates debating at 7 p.m. are:

    New Jersey Governor Chris Christie
    Former Arkansas Governor Mike Huckabee
    Louisiana Governor Bobby Jindal
    Former Pennsylvania Senator Rick Santorum
    The mainstage candidates debating at 9 p.m. are:

    Donald Trump
    Dr. Ben Carson
    Florida Senator Marco Rubio
    Texas Senator Ted Cruz
    Former Florida Governor Jeb Bush
    Carly Fiorina
    Ohio Governor John Kasich
    Kentucky Senator Rand Paul

    How to watch:

    You’ll Now Be Able to Watch the Fox Business GOP Debate Online

    Tessa Berenson
    Nov. 5, 2015

    You won't need a cable TV subscription

    Fox Business, which is hosting the next Republican debate on Nov. 10, will stream the program online for free.

    The debate will be streamed for free on Foxbusiness.com, Politico reports, without the need for a cable TV subscription. Fox Business will also unbundle from some of its partners including DirecTV and Mediacom to allow people who wouldn’t normally have access to the channel watch the debate.
